Out next port of call is Mevagissey for their increasing popular and fun shanty festival from Friday October 13th to Sunday October 15th. We will be performing seven (yes seven!) times over the weekend – so no excuse not to find us somewhere sometime!

The full Mevagissey programme can be found here and we will be singing at the following venues and times:

The Cellar Bar – Friday 10pm and Saturday 4pm

The Ship Inn – 7pm Saturday and 3pm Sunday

The Social Club – 9pm Saturday

We will also be singing at various times in the Ship Inn Pentewan – full details on the shanty festival website soon!
